Analysis
The most recent figure for hen eggs in shell, fresh β emissions (co2eq) in Syrian Arab Republic is 56.6 kt, measured in 2023.
That represents a change of up 7.3% on the previous year and down 21.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, hen eggs in shell, fresh β emissions (co2eq) in Syrian Arab Republic peaked at 118.43 kt in 2004 and was at its lowest, 9.26 kt, in 1967.
That places Syrian Arab Republic 83rd out of 209 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 11.82 kt | 9.26 kt | 14.47 kt | 9 |
| 1970s | 22.87 kt | 11.17 kt | 47.92 kt | 10 |
| 1980s | 52.07 kt | 45.16 kt | 57.48 kt | 10 |
| 1990s | 67.82 kt | 54.36 kt | 77.33 kt | 10 |
| 2000s | 96.08 kt | 78.88 kt | 118.43 kt | 10 |
| 2010s | 73.56 kt | 58.86 kt | 97.11 kt | 10 |
| 2020s | 60.8 kt | 52.75 kt | 71.45 kt | 4 |

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ions intensities contains analytical data on the intensity of gre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ions by agricultural commodity. This indicator is defined as greenhouse gas emissions per kg of product. Data are available for a set of agricultural commodities (e.g. rice and other cereals, meat, milk, eggs), by country, with global coverage.
